Echeveria purpusorum f. politomica is a captivating, slow-growing succulent that forms a compact, symmetrical rosette of thick, fleshy leaves. Renowned for its striking, speckled appearance, this rare form displays a distinctive mottling of reddish‑brown markings on an olive to grey‑green base, making it a sought‑after addition to any collection. The leaves are sharply pointed, triangular, and arranged in a tight, architectural formation, reaching approximately 7–8 cm in diameter at maturity.

Native to the mountainous habitats of Puebla and Oaxaca in southern Mexico, this form has evolved to tolerate harsh, rocky terrain and intensifying light. Its natural beauty is often enhanced by stress, with brighter light or cooler temperatures intensifying the deep reddish‑brown spots that characterise its thick leaves. In spring and early summer, it produces arching flower stalks adorned with bell‑shaped blooms in warm shades of reddish‑orange, accented by golden‑yellow tips.

Echeveria purpusorum f. politomica is well suited to potted displays, shallow bowls, or rock gardens and is an ideal candidate for succulent terrariums. It thrives in a position with bright, indirect light or partial sun and appreciates a very free‑draining, mineral‑rich soil. Watering should be sparse, allowing the soil to dry completely between drinks, and it should be protected from excessive humidity and cold temperatures.

This species propagates readily from leaves or offsets, making it an excellent choice for succulent enthusiasts looking to expand their collection. Its bold, spotted foliage and beautifully compact form offer a timeless appeal, making it an intriguing and rewarding plant for both novice and experienced growers alike.
